### Step 4 — Restore cache invalidation triggers

Following the Hollybrook stale-cache incident, the postmortem required re-creating the invalidation triggers dropped during the v7 migration. Apply `triggers_v8.sql` to the catalog database before re-enabling the cache layer, otherwise readers will serve stale entries again. Verify trigger presence with the included check script. Run the script against the catalog database using the connection string below.

primary connection of yagep-kahip = redis://giliel_svc:zYiKsLL2PLpfPL@db-348f.xolmarsys.corp:5432/fenwyn

### Step 4: Register the schedule in Flowharbor

With the legacy cron entries exported, each job becomes a Flowharbor workflow with an explicit schedule, retry policy, and owner tag. Do not copy crontab lines verbatim; Flowharbor evaluates schedules in the tenant's zone, not UTC. Register the workflow, then pin it to the shared worker pool. The scheduler expects the following configuration values.

settings of kajeg-kafop:
OLIWYN_HOST=oliwyn.qorvelsys.internal
OLIWYN_PORT=9000

- [ ] Step 7: Archive cold storage buckets (Glacierline tier). Confirm both ceremony witnesses are present, verify bucket manifests match the Oxbow ledger, then seal the archive key shares. Plugin authors may observe but not handle shares. Once sealed, the archive index itself is encrypted and can only be reopened with the passphrase below.

vault phrase of badup-hahig = tamael-aldael-kelmir-istael-fenok-istwyn-tamius-jorath-oliion